Current news:
=> In a rare occurrence, a tornado was seen in Barpeta district of Assam.
=> No deaths or injuries were reported.
=> The tornado started from the banks of the Brahmaputra river, which flows close to Rowmari village, and remained restricted to a small area.
Tornadoes:
=> Tornadoes are formed when cold air packet meets a warm air packet.
=> The warmer wind having more speed and more energy starts climbing over the cool air packet.
=> When the warm Wind rises it leads to formation of large cumulonimbus clouds and heavy rainfall associated with huge thunderstorm.
=> When the clouds becomes too heavy it falls to a particular location causing massive damage.
=> Tornadoes formation mechanism is similar to that of Cyclones.
=> But unlike cyclones which are found on ocean, tornadoes are formed on land.
=> Tornadoes occur in many places across the globe, but they are most likely to form in the United States.
=> In fact, the United States has more tornadoes each year than any other country.
Why?
=> The moist, warm air from the Gulf of Mexico frequently meets the cool, dry air from Canada, which prompts formation of Tornadoes.
